The term "suppressal" often evokes curiosity due to its relatively rare usage in the English language. While it might not be a frequently encountered word, its roots and implications are significant in various contexts, particularly in psychology, linguistics, and even in everyday life.
At its core, "suppressal" is derived from the verb "suppress," which means to forcibly put an end to something or to prevent the expression or development of an idea, emotion, or behavior. When we analyze "suppressal," it typically refers to the act or process of suppressing, often highlighting the ongoing effects or the consequences of such an action.
